The BBL10 Team of the Tournament has been released, with four players earning a place in the 13-man side with maximum votes.

All eight club coaches voted for the 11-man side that also includes two X-Factor players, with Sixers wicketkeeper Josh Philippe, Thunder opener Alex Hales, Hobart batsman Ben McDermott and Scorchers' New Zealand export Colin Munro earning a place unanimously.

Despite failing to make the finals, the Melbourne Stars had three inclusions into the side, with captain Glenn Maxwell named at No.5, spinner Adam Zampa earning a spot in the tail and big-hitter Marcus Stoinis taking out an X-Factor position.

Sydney Thunder star Daniel Sams took out the other sub position, with Dan Christian (Sixers), Rashid Khan (Strikers), Jhye Richardson (Scorchers), Mark Steketee (Brisbane) and Wes Agar (Strikers) manning the bottom half of the order.

BBL10 Team of the Tournament:

1) Josh Philippe – 8 votes

2) Alex Hales – 8 votes

3) Ben McDermott – 8 votes

4) Colin Munro – 8 votes

5) Glenn Maxwell – 5 votes

6) Dan Christian – 6 votes

7) Rashid Khan – 6 votes

8) Jhye Richardson – 8 votes

9) Mark Steketee – 6 votes

10) Adam Zampa – 6 votes

11) Wes Agar – 7 votes

X-Factor players:

12) Marcus Stoinis – 4 votes

13) Daniel Sams – 3 votes
